About the Item

A fine pair of 19th century Prior-Hamblin School oil on paperboard portraits, identified as John & Sally Eaton, parents of AH Harris, unsigned, and housed in wooden frames with a marbled finish. Small labels identifying the sitters can be found on verso of each. Good overall condition, with some surface rubs, paint losses in spots, and wear commensurate with age and use. One frame has a small crack. Dimensions: 14.13 in H x 8.13 in W, actual; 17.13 in H x 11.13 in W x 1 in D.
